Skip to main content

Featured Hotels Near Urquhart Castle

Filter by:


Star Rating

5 stars 4 stars 3 stars 2 stars 1 star

Review Score

Wonderful: 9+ Very Good: 8+ Good: 7+ Pleasant: 6+
Our top picks Lowest Price First Star rating and price Top reviewed

See the latest prices and deals by choosing your dates.

Urquhart Bay Croft

Drumnadrochit (0.9 miles from Urquhart Castle)

Located in Drumnadrochit, just 14 mi from Inverness Castle, Urquhart Bay Croft features a garden with barbecue and views of Loch Ness and the mountains. Free private parking and WiFi is available.

Show more Show less
9.8
Exceptional
67 reviews
Price from
£145
per night

Woodlands Bed & Breakfast

Drumnadrochit (1.3 miles from Urquhart Castle)

Featuring quiet street views, Woodlands Bed & Breakfast in Drumnadrochit offers accommodations and a garden. This bed and breakfast features free private parking, luggage storage space, and free Wifi....

Show more Show less
9.8
Exceptional
157 reviews
Price from
£141
per night

Balmridge House, Loch Ness, Bed & Breakfast

Drumnadrochit (1.3 miles from Urquhart Castle)

Balmridge House, Loch Ness, Bed & Breakfast is a recently renovated bed and breakfast in Drumnadrochit where guests can make the most of its garden and shared lounge.

Show more Show less
9.7
Exceptional
175 reviews
Price from
£166
per night

Urquhart Bay B&B

Drumnadrochit (1.1 miles from Urquhart Castle)

Set in Drumnadrochit, rquhart Bay B&B offers accommodations by Loch Ness. The rooms have a patio with mountain views and free WiFi.

Show more Show less
9.8
Exceptional
161 reviews

Rooms at Elmbank near Loch Ness

Drumnadrochit (1.2 miles from Urquhart Castle)

Rooms at Elmbank near Loch Ness is located in the beautiful village of Drumnadrochit, near the banks of Loch Ness and Urquhart Castle.

Show more Show less
9.6
Exceptional
99 reviews

Bunillidh

Drumnadrochit (1.4 miles from Urquhart Castle)

Bunillidh is located in Drumnadrochit, just 16 miles from Inverness Castle and 16 miles from Inverness Train Station.

Show more Show less
9.5
Exceptional
161 reviews
Price from
£81
per night

Top 10 trending hotels near Urquhart Castle

Discover our most popular hotels from the last 30 days

Enjoy breakfast at hotels near Urquhart Castle

  • Bunchrew House Hotel
    9.0
    Scored 9.0
    Wonderful
    Rated wonderful
     · 1,203 reviews

    In 20 acres of beautiful landscaped gardens and woodland, on the shores of the Beauly Firth near Inverness, this 17th-century Scottish mansion is now a luxurious 4-star country house hotel.

    Location, cleanliness, atmosphere and friendliness

  • 9.0
    Scored 9.0
    Wonderful
    Rated wonderful
     · 425 reviews

    Foyers House is a small family-run adult only guest house on the South side of Loch Ness. Foyers House has an enviable location having one of the highest view points above Loch Ness.

    Everything, food, hosts, location, room... will be back

  • AC Hotel by Marriott Inverness
    8.7
    Scored 8.7
    Excellent
    Rated excellent
     · 1,133 reviews

    Ideally located in Inverness, AC Hotel by Marriott Inverness has air-conditioned rooms, a fitness center, free WiFi and a terrace. This 4-star hotel offers a 24-hour front desk and a business center.

    Wonderful trip to Inverness,couldn’t fault the hotel.

  • River Ness Hotel, a member of Radisson Individuals
    8.7
    Scored 8.7
    Excellent
    Rated excellent
     · 5,494 reviews

    Attractively located in the center of Inverness, River Ness Hotel, a member of Radisson Individuals has air-conditioned rooms, a fitness center, free WiFi and a shared lounge.

    Everything. Great room, great location, great service.

  • Inverness Lochardil House
    8.7
    Scored 8.7
    Excellent
    Rated excellent
     · 1,228 reviews

    Just 1 and a half miles from the center of Inverness, Lochardil House offers comfortable accommodations. Set in attractive gardens, Lochardil House provides free parking and Wi-Fi.

    Welcoming, attentive staff. Comfortable rooms. Great food.

  • Best Western Inverness Palace Hotel & Spa
    8.1
    Scored 8.1
    Very Good
    Rated very good
     · 2,602 reviews

    Opposite Inverness Castle, Best Western Palace Hotel & Spa is located on the banks of the River Ness.

    It had a very grand feel to it and it was very warm

  • The Glenmoriston Townhouse Hotel
    8.3
    Scored 8.3
    Very Good
    Rated very good
     · 1,714 reviews

    This stylish, 4-star property sits on the banks of the River Ness and is 2625 feet from Inverness city center.

    All staff were wonderful and exceptionally friendly

  • Loch Ness Clansman Hotel
    8.2
    Scored 8.2
    Very Good
    Rated very good
     · 1,153 reviews

    On the shores of Loch Ness and 10 minutes' drive from Inverness, the Clansman Hotel offers rooms with views across the water and free Wi-Fi in the public areas.

    The location was amazing and the food and service was excellent

Budget hotels near Urquhart Castle

  • Ness Walk
    9.3
    Scored 9.3
    Wonderful
    Rated wonderful
     · 1,379 reviews

    Ness Walk features free WiFi and rooms with air conditioning in Inverness. Boasting a terrace, this hotel is set near attractions such as Inverness Castle. The property has a restaurant.

    Decor Cleanliness Attentive staff Warm and welcoming

  • Heathmount Hotel
    9.0
    Scored 9.0
    Wonderful
    Rated wonderful
     · 1,490 reviews

    The centrally located Heathmount Hotel is 10 minutes’ walk from Inverness Castle, and offers Scottish whiskey, Illy coffee and freshly mixed cocktails in its 2 contrasting bars.

    Location excellent Central Location food excellent

  • Whitebridge Hotel
    9.0
    Scored 9.0
    Wonderful
    Rated wonderful
     · 479 reviews

    Whitebridge Hotel in the small village of Whitebridge provides comfortable bedrooms with attached bathroom, a traditional bar serving evening meals and has a garden, a terrace and a bar.

    Great stylish place with delicious food and friendly staff. Thank you!

  • Loch Ness Lodge
    9.1
    Scored 9.1
    Wonderful
    Rated wonderful
     · 442 reviews

    This elegant and intimate exclusive retreat in the heart of the Scottish Highlands overlooks the mysterious and beautiful Loch Ness.

    Beautiful building and setting. Lovely views from common areas and our bedrooms. Staff were fantastic.

  • Blackfriars
    8.6
    Scored 8.6
    Excellent
    Rated excellent
     · 1,090 reviews

    Conveniently set in the center of Inverness, Blackfriars provides free WiFi throughout the property and a bar.

    The room was very comfy. The facilities were great.

  • Lock Chambers, Caledonian Canal Centre
    8.8
    Scored 8.8
    Excellent
    Rated excellent
     · 1,020 reviews

    Lock Chambers, Caledonian Canal Centre is offering accommodations in Fort Augustus. The property is non-smoking throughout and is located 16 miles from Urquhart Castle.

    Lots of restaurants and shops in easy walking distance

  • Old North Inn Hotel, Inverness
    8.1
    Scored 8.1
    Very Good
    Rated very good
     · 1,200 reviews

    Located just 7 miles from the city of Inverness, Old North Inn Hotel, Inverness is just a 20-minute from the famous Loch Ness and Culloden Battlefield.

    We've had a good time, nice place and lovely people 😊

  • Chieftain Hotel
    8.2
    Scored 8.2
    Very Good
    Rated very good
     · 1,643 reviews

    The Chieftain Hotel in Inverness offers bed and breakfast accommodations, within a 4-minute drive of the city center and train station.

    Friendly staff Amazing breakfast included in price

Hotels with great access to Urquhart Castle!

  • Muir Bank
    8.9
    Scored 8.9
    Excellent
    Rated excellent
     · 917 reviews

    Located in Muir of Ord, within 13 miles of Inverness Castle and 8.3 miles of Strathpeffer Spa Golf Club, Muir Bank has accommodations with a shared lounge and free WiFi throughout the property as well...

    Proximity to town - staff were extremely helpful - very clean

  • North Kessock Hotel
    8.7
    Scored 8.7
    Excellent
    Rated excellent
     · 876 reviews

    Located in Inverness, 5.1 miles from Inverness Castle, North Kessock Hotel provides accommodations with a garden, free private parking, a terrace and a restaurant.

    Nice view on the see, quiet place, very good restaurant

  • Loch Ness Country House Hotel
    8.6
    Scored 8.6
    Excellent
    Rated excellent
     · 489 reviews

    The Loch Ness Country House Hotel offers excellent food and elegant rooms. It is a striking Georgian building in 6 acres of gardens, 1.9 mi from Inverness city center.

    Amazing food, very comfortable bed and lovely friendly staff.

  • Kingsmills Hotel
    8.6
    Scored 8.6
    Excellent
    Rated excellent
     · 4,583 reviews

    Set in 4 acres of beautiful gardens, the Kingsmill Hotel has a spa, a swimming pool and free parking. Inverness city center is just one mile away.

    Very friendly and my hubby loved the leisure facilities

  • Rocpool Reserve Luxury Highland Package
    8.5
    Scored 8.5
    Very Good
    Rated very good
     · 277 reviews

    We are thrilled to announce that Rocpool Reserve Luxury Highland Package is undergoing refurbishment and will reopen its doors on April 1, 2024, as an exquisite, exclusive residents-only hotel.

    Really helpful staff, comfy bed and tasty breakfast

  • The Priory Hotel
    8.4
    Scored 8.4
    Very Good
    Rated very good
     · 672 reviews

    Located in the heart of the Scottish Highlands, The Priory Hotel is located in the center of the picturesque village of Beauly and offers its guests traditional Highland hospitality.

    Standard of room and facilities. Breakfast very good.

  • Foyers Roost
    8.2
    Scored 8.2
    Very Good
    Rated very good
     · 409 reviews

    High above the world famous Loch Ness, home to the elusive Loch Ness Monster, Foyers Roost offers views across the loch and beautiful mountains surrounding it. There is free parking and free WiFi.

    Everything. Location, cleanliness, food and whisky

  • Macdonald Drumossie Hotel Inverness
    8.2
    Scored 8.2
    Very Good
    Rated very good
     · 753 reviews

    Set in 9 acres of private parkland, in the heart of the Highlands, Macdonald Drumossie Hotel is only 10 minutes’ drive from the center of Inverness and has free parking.

    Evening Meal was excellent Room was first class

Research, refine, and make plans for your whole trip

gogless